When a customer says "we use Sage," they could mean any of dozens of distinct products from 20-year-old regional desktop software to modern cloud platforms like Sage Intacct or Sage Active. Your integration strategy requires pinpointing the exact product, since the ecosystem is fragmented by region, market segment, and technology stack.
